Recipe View In a large bowl, whisk together the white sugar, brown sugar, sea salt, New Mexico red chile powder, garlic powder, onion powder, Hungarian paprika, ancho chile powder, black pepper, thyme, cumin, rosemary, nutmeg, allspice, and cayenne pepper until thoroughly combined. (5 minutes)

Image Step 02
02 Step

Recipe View Generously rub the spice mixture onto your ribs or other preferred cut of meat, ensuring an even coating on all sides. (10 minutes)

Image Step 03
03 Step

Recipe View Wrap the rubbed meat tightly in plastic wrap or place it in a resealable bag. Refrigerate for at least 8 hours, or preferably overnight, to allow the flavors to penetrate deeply. (8-12 hours)

For a sweeter profile, increase the brown sugar by a tablespoon or two.
Adjust the cayenne pepper to your liking. If you prefer a milder rub, reduce the amount or omit it entirely.
This rub is also excellent on pork shoulder, chicken, or even brisket.
